Multiply 80/6 with 70/54

1st number: 13 2/6, 2nd number: 1 16/54

This multiplication involving fractions can also be rephrased as "What is 80/6 of 1 16/54?"

80/6 × 70/54 is 1400/81.

Steps for multiplying fractions

  1. Simply multiply the numerators and denominators separately:
  2. 80/6 × 70/54 = 80 × 70/6 × 54 = 5600/324
  3. After reducing the fraction, the answer is 1400/81
